[Chartjs]-Primevue Chart not rendered


Remove chart.js and then install this version, worked for me (but i use vue 3, maybe you need another version) :

npm i chart.js@2.9.4


According to documentation on https://www.primefaces.org/primevue/showcase/#/chart/line

I think you are missing the options attribute inside Chart tag:

<chart type="line" :data="chartData" :options="chartOptions" />

And put the object inside the data return from vue export:

data() {
    return {
      chartData: {
        labels: ["Label"],
        datasets: [
            label: "Dataset",
            backgroundColor: "#5F5F5F",
            data: [99],
      chartOptions: {
        plugins: {
          legend: {
            labels: {
              color: '#495057'
        scales: {
          x: {
            ticks: {
              color: '#495057'
            grid: {
              color: '#ebedef'
          y: {
            ticks: {
              color: '#495057'
            grid: {
              color: '#ebedef'

